This is the core change brought about by the YYNote to-do plug-in. It is not the kind of independent software that you need to open and close intentionally. Instead, it is presented as a transparent plug-in, deeply embedded in your system desktop, blending with your favorite wallpapers. You can see it as soon as you turn on the computer, and you can query it at any time. This truly solves the most fundamental pain point of "because you can't see it, so you can't remember it", so that you no longer need to constantly switch between different applications or tabs to find the task list.

Its power is not limited to being as simple as "sticking it to the desktop". In the face of complicated tasks, you can create multiple lists that belong to you specifically to distinguish "work-related projects", "personal study content" or "family matters"; with the help of the intelligently operated [tag] system, when adding new tasks, you can automatically group them into categories, so that all aspects of management work can be carried out in an orderly and methodical manner. For fixed things that repeat on a daily, weekly or monthly basis (such as "Team meeting every Wednesday" or "Repay credit card on the 5th of every month"), you only need to set a flexible recurrence rule once, and YYNote will automatically generate future to-dos for you, completely freeing your memory.
The operation experience is also extremely smooth. You can use the mouse to drag and drop to sort, adjust the order of tasks according to priority, and put the most important item on top with one click to ensure that it gets absolute visual focus. Set countdown reminders for important deadlines. Looking at labels like "Project Delivery – 3 Days Left", a sense of urgency and planning will naturally arise. Every design is dedicated to minimizing operating costs in exchange for maximum control over tasks.
At the end of the day or week, all completed items are automatically archived, keeping your list clean and focusing only on unfinished tasks. This kind of "visual burden reduction" can create a huge sense of psychological relaxation.
